I spent quite some time hunting this book down after beinghooked by all the "science-faction" hype, and thesensational reviews on Amazon.com. I love good fiction and am seriously interested in UFOlogy. Unfortunately, I was let down in all areas, and a Jackson lighter in the pocket. For starters, the writing is mediocre pulp at best. Bottom line, anyone here who says this is "great writing" doesn't know great writing. The editing is suprisingly shoddy with multiple grammatical and spelling errors. The characters are a notch above stereotype. The plot line has sonar pings coming off it from ten miles out. Other than the TR-3B craft information, I found nothing new anywhere between the covers. All in all, this is the kind of book that you accidentally spill suntan oil on during your summer beach vacation. With that said, however, UFOology research does seem to reach a point of diminishing returns much like heroin addiction. You're always looking for the next "lid-blowing" revelation, the next big fix. So, for those who aren't so steeped in the field, and aren't bothered by mediocre writing this might be just the ticket. To be honest, certain books that blew me away several years ago now seem trite. It's like the comedian says to the young drunk kid in the crowd, "Yeah, I remember when I had my first beer, too. Keep drinkin', kid."
